question text To ask the Secretary of State for Education, how much his Department spent on consultancy fees in the last five years. more like this
tabling member constituency North East Fife more like this
tabling member printed
Wendy Chamberlain more like this
uin 22552 more like this
answer
answer
is ministerial correction false more like this
date of answer less than 2022-07-01more like thismore than 2022-07-01
answer text <p>Consultancy expenditure is published in the department’s annual report and accounts, available at: <a href="https://www.gov.uk/government/collections/dfe-annual-reports" target="_blank">https://www.gov.uk/government/collections/dfe-annual-reports</a>. <br> <br> Although the audit is still ongoing, figures for the 2021/22 financial year are included. As a result, this value may be subject to change.</p><p> </p><p>The figures below cover the entirety of the departmental group, including executive agencies and non-departmental public bodies, for the years specified:</p><ul><li>2021/22: £6.8 million (unaudited)</li><li>2020/21: £8.7 million</li><li>2019/20: £12.7 million</li><li>2018/19: £13.1 million</li><li>2017/18: £14.6 million.</li></ul><p> </p> more like this

question text To ask the Secretary of State for Education, what discussions he has had with relevant stakeholders on the decision to exclude staff mobility from the Turing Scheme; and what assessment he has made of the impact of that decision on staff and participants under the scheme. more like this
tabling member constituency North East Fife more like this
tabling member printed
Wendy Chamberlain more like this
uin 10015 more like this
answer
answer
is ministerial correction false more like this
date of answer less than 2022-06-06more like thismore than 2022-06-06
answer text <p>Teaching and college staff mobility will not be funded as part of the Turing Scheme in the 2022/23 academic year, to maximise the amount of student, learner, and pupils’ access to life-changing mobilities. The department will continue to keep this decision under review and plans to assess the impact of the scheme following its first year of delivery.</p> more like this
